Subject: The employment of women by employers of women under the Karnataka Devadasis (Prohibition of Dedication) Act, 1982, regarding.
In exercise of the powers conferred by section 9 of the Karnataka Devadasis (Prohibition of Dedication) Act, 1982 (Karnataka Act 1 of 1982), the Women and Child Development Department, Government of Karnataka hereby issues the following Standing Order for the guidance of all officers subordinate to it:
1. References have been received seeking clarification on the manner in which section 9 applies to the employment of women by employers of women.
2. The matter has been examined. Every employer of women carrying on the employment of women shall make an application in Form I to the Committee within thirty days, accompanied by a fee of ten rupees.
3. The Child Welfare Officer shall ensure that report is dealt with as directed above, and shall report compliance to the Committee within thirty days.
4. Difficulties, if any, in the implementation of this standing order may be brought to the notice of the Women and Child Development Department, Government of Karnataka.
